Job description

Our customer is a social video-sharing app where users can shoot and edit short

You will support our customer as Content Moderator in a state of the art contact center in You're daily tasks include:

    • Content moderation of content in the Dutch language;
    • Remove and block content, filter, order and analyse information;
    • Content management to avoid certain aspects of cyber crime;
    • Remove content which does not meet ethical and/or legal requirements;
    • The to be removed content can contain (among others) criminal acts, torture, violence, hate speech and cyberbullying, terrorism and violence against
